Default checked out a 2012 GT today - what's with the 5.0 exhaust?

It was nice and I'm considering buying it as a second mustang. But tbh the exhaust note was pathetic! It was quiet as a regular car up until 5k where it has a nice scream...but where's the rumble??

Currently have a 06 GT (stock exhaust) and before this I had a 98 GT, i really love the rumble that both these cars have...but the exhaust note on the 5.0 doesn't sit right with me, especially since they have like a hundred more horsepower!

I don't race or anything and I usually drive conservatively...so I like having that low end rumble which lets me drive safely and still sound nasty.

Is there any axel back kits or catbacks you can put on the 5.0 to get that nice rumble? cus looking at youtube videos even a lot of the axel backs just sound like slightly louder versions of the stock exhaust :/

What sounds good to one person is gonna sound bad to another, opinions are like a-holes, everyone has one. There are several axle back systems that sound good. It is probably the resonator that is taking out the rumble that you're looking for but then that is my opinion. Check your local Mustang club or just listen for one that you like and ask the guy what he has, that is the safest way. I agree that videos don't really do justice to the real sound in person.

No, this engine does not have a traditional v8 rumble, and that is because it is not a traditional v8.

The exhaust I've heard that changes the tone the most in the way you're looking for is MAC.
